Aline MacMahon

Born May 3, 1899 · McKeesport, Pennsylvania, USA

Died October 12, 1991 · aged 92

Aline MacMahon was an American stage, screen, and television actress. She worked extensively from 1921, when she began appearing on Broadway, until her full retirement from acting in 1975. MacMahon was nominated for an Academy Award for Best Supporting Actress for her performance in the 1944 film Dragon Seed.
